Overview:
This position is located in North Stonington, CT as part of Manufacturing Engineering for the Columbia and Virginia Class programs.  Manufacturing Engineering develops, researches, designs, and procures special tools, fixtures, and other manufacturing aids required to facilitate submarine construction, maintenance, and overhaul on all classes.  D467 Manufacturing Engineering is seeking a highly motivated Project Coordinator Technical Aid (PCTA) to assist Management and Supervision in the planning, execution and documentation of team activities.  Job assignments will be varied and include:

Create and update product list spreadsheets on a weekly basis and host weekly meetings to obtain detailed product status from each supervisor

Submit product progressing weekly using the prescribed method for each program

Support the preparation of power point slides for major program reviews and executive updates

Provide oversight to Manufacturing Engineering Manager and Staff’s calendars and schedules

Track all departmental commitments, maintaining and reporting status weekly

Monitor and track all departmental correspondence, including verification of accurate security labeling, proper peer or senior technical reviews, accuracy of transferring internal and external commitments and completing internal and external distribution

Prepare business travel arrangements for departmental staff

Coordinate on-site and off-site meetings, including preparing and issuing Agendas, identifying participants from all stakeholders, coordinating attendee’s schedules, coordinating travel arrangements for EB personnel

Monitor and maintain Departmental Overhead Budget

Provide oversight to Cornerstone training for departmental staff and ensure compliance with company requirements

Provide oversight to Department Hiring efforts

Track Departmental labor charging

Generate business travel expense reports

Coordinate access to off-site facilities for departmental staff

Assist with administrative tasks such as onboarding, submitting service tickets and communication work orders, ordering department supplies and facility requests.

Qualifications:
Required:

5+ years experience in manufacturing or administrative roles

High School Diploma

Secret security clearance

Preferred:

Associate degree or certificate program completion

Skills:
Successful candidate must possess strong computer and communication skills, flexibility, excel proficiency, interpersonal skills, a strong team commitment, be customer focused, high energy and the ability to work well with all levels of internal management and staff. Sensitivity to confidential human resource information (CHRI) matters may be required.

 

Specific skills requirements include but are not limited to the following:

Strong organizational skills

Basic administrative skills

Proficiency in typing

Proficiency in MS Office

MS Word -basic skills of editing, formatting and use of track changes as well as advance skills with developing and formatting tables, flow charts, and block diagrams

MS Excel -basic skills of building data tables, developing charts, manipulating table and chart formats to use in reporting documents, as well as advance skills with developing and maintaining databases using calculation functions and automatic updating features

MS Power Point -basic skills with developing and updating slides/slide master and inserting and formatting information extracted from external documents as well as advance skills creating tables and charts to be embedded, and developing custom slide presentations

MS Project -basic skills of developing detailed schedules with activities and associated start and finish dates as well as advance skills developing predecessor and successor linked activities, resource loading and activity progress tracking

In depth knowledge and use of CONCUR

Knowledge and use of Commitments and Commitment Report Databases

Ability to learn and use iCIMS

Proven performance for delivering products with accuracy and timeliness
